At first glance 13/6 merely adds another spare to the 6 point, but it's fairly safe, creating no more blots while the 22 point blot is in little danger. 13/11 13/8 diversifies builders, giving a few (and only a few) numbers to make the 3, 4, 7 or 8 point. But White will have 9 hitting numbers im the outfield. Or Blue could hit 6/1* 13/11, giving 11 hitting numbers, but taking away half the roll.
Since none of these plays do much, and bringing two down or hitting on the acepoint turns many of White's rather average numbers into good numbers, and the pip count is tied after the play, which makes White a slight favorite in the race (in addition to White's positional advantage), which suggests that simply running the back checker is a good plan for White, and that giving White the chance to run with tempo by hitting in the outfield is a definite minus for Blue, I'd play 13/6, boring as it may be.
